- 1
- 5
- 1
- 1
Kashmir is a region located in the northern part of the Indian subcontinent. It is known for its breathtaking natural beauty, snow-capped mountains, and serene valleys. The region is administered in parts by India, Pakistan, and China, with the Indian-administered portion often referred to as Jammu and Kashmir. Nestled in the Himalayas, it features popular destinations like Srinagar, Dal Lake, and Gulmarg. Kashmir has a complex political history but remains a symbol of natural paradise in South Asia.